
Rosenthal meets Versace »Medusa Red«
At the center of the opulent collection »Medusa Red« by Rosenthal meets Versace is the brand's iconic symbol: The head of Medusa. This recurring female head with snake hair from Versace originates from Greek mythology. The expressive colors red and black, together with shiny gold, frame the golden Medusa head on plates, cups, and other items. The designs are characterized by a baroque-like opulence typical of many creations from the house of Versace.
The design of key items also reflects the luxurious lifestyle of the Versace world: The cups are available with either a round handle or a golden Icarus wing as a cup handle. The lid knob of the small teapot is designed as a button, while other hollow parts like the coffee pot or sugar bowl feature the lying wing. In addition to classic service items, Rosenthal meets Versace »Medusa Red« offers a wide range of products: This includes bowls and dishes in various sizes and shapes, three vases, and high-quality sets that are perfect for gifting: A tea set »Tea for 2«, consisting of two teacups with saucers along with the small teapot, and a four-piece bowl set, which includes three different sized bowls plus a lid for the 18 cm bowl.
All items from Rosenthal meets Versace »Medusa Red« are available in a gift box.
